Questions You Might Need to Know About Traveling to Hongseong
Hongseong County, located in the southwestern part of South Korea's Chungcheongnam-do, boasts rich natural landscapes and historical heritage. Known for its pristine coastline, traditional farming culture, and slow-paced lifestyle, it is an ideal escape from urban bustle. The county's seafood markets and fresh agricultural products are highlights, perfect for travelers seeking tranquility and authentic Korean rural experiences.
Hongseong Beach is the top summer destination, with crystal-clear waters ideal for swimming and sunbathing. Hongseong Traditional Market offers a glimpse of local life, featuring fresh seafood and handicrafts. The ancient Daeheung Temple, with its millennium-old architecture and serene surroundings, is a must-visit for meditation and cultural exploration.
Must-try dishes include spicy braised hairtail and fresh oysters, renowned for their freshness. Locally grown Hongseong chili peppers and garlic add unique flavors to meals. These delicacies are affordable and widely available in markets or small eateries.
Public transport relies on buses, with intercity buses connecting to Daejeon or Seoul. Within the county, local buses or taxis are recommended; check schedules in advance. Renting a car provides flexibility for exploring rural areas. Note that bus frequencies are limited in the countryside.
The best time to visit is May to October, with warm weather ideal for beach activities. Summers (July-August) are busier, while spring and autumn offer quieter experiences.
Korean is the primary language; translation apps are helpful in rural areas. Mobile coverage is good, and prepaid SIM cards are sold at convenience stores. Cash is preferred, though cards work in larger establishments. For emergencies, dial 119. Hongseong County Hospital provides basic care. Voltage is 220V with Type C/F outlets.
